Local tips
- Visit early in the morning or late in the afternoon for the best light and fewer crowds.
- Bring sturdy walking shoes, as some trails can be uneven and rugged.
- Pack a picnic to enjoy amidst the stunning scenery.
- Check the weather forecast before your visit, as conditions can change rapidly.
- Stay hydrated and bring plenty of water, especially if you plan to hike.

Getting There
-
Car
If you are traveling by car, start your journey from the Þingvellir National Park which is a central point in the Golden Circle. From the main entrance of Þingvellir, head southeast on Þingvallavegur (Route 36) for about 10 kilometers. After approximately 10 kilometers, turn left onto Vallarvegur. Follow Vallarvegur for about 3 kilometers until you reach Lambhagi at the address Vallarvegur, 806. There is no parking fee at Lambhagi.
-
Public Transportation
To reach Lambhagi via public transportation, you will first need to take a bus from Reykjavík to Þingvellir National Park. Buses run regularly from the BSI Bus Terminal in Reykjavík to Þingvellir. Once you arrive at Þingvellir, you can use local taxi services or ride-sharing apps to get to Lambhagi, which is about a 15-minute drive away. Make sure to check the local bus schedules and taxi availability in advance, as they may vary, and be prepared for possible costs associated with the taxi ride.
